在数字化时代,网络安全成为了每一个组织和个人都不能忽视的重要课题。DDoS(分布式拒绝服务)攻击作为一种常见的网络攻击手段,其破坏力不容小觑。本文将为你揭秘如何轻松应对DDoS攻击,并提供一系列网络安全必备软件攻略。
DDoS攻击的原理与危害
DDoS攻击原理
DDoS攻击通过大量合法的请求淹没目标系统资源,使其无法正常处理合法用户的请求,从而达到瘫痪服务器的目的。攻击者通常会利用僵尸网络(Botnet)来发起攻击,这些僵尸网络由大量被黑客控制的计算机组成。
DDoS攻击的危害
- 经济损失:攻击可能导致企业网站和服务中断,造成直接的经济损失。
- 品牌形象受损:频繁的攻击可能导致用户对品牌信任度下降。
- 业务中断:对于依赖网络的业务来说,DDoS攻击可能导致业务中断,影响客户满意度。
- 数据泄露:在攻击过程中,黑客可能趁机窃取敏感数据。
应对DDoS攻击的软件攻略
1. 防火墙
防火墙是网络安全的第一道防线,它能够过滤掉恶意流量,防止DDoS攻击。以下是一些优秀的防火墙软件:
- iptables:一款开源的Linux防火墙,功能强大,配置灵活。
- Windows Firewall:Windows系统自带的防火墙,易于配置和使用。
2. 入侵检测系统(IDS)
入侵检测系统可以实时监控网络流量,识别可疑行为,并及时发出警报。以下是一些常见的IDS软件:
- Snort:一款开源的IDS,功能强大,易于扩展。
- Suricata:一款高性能的IDS,支持多种数据源。
3. 入侵防御系统(IPS)
入侵防御系统可以在检测到恶意流量时,立即采取措施阻止攻击。以下是一些IPS软件:
- Bro:一款开源的IDS/IPS,功能强大,易于配置。
- ClamAV:一款开源的病毒扫描软件,可以与IPS结合使用。
4. DDoS防护服务
对于大型企业和关键基础设施,可以考虑使用专业的DDoS防护服务。以下是一些知名的DDoS防护服务提供商:
- Cloudflare:提供DDoS防护、Web应用防火墙等服务。
- Akamai:提供DDoS防护、内容分发网络等服务。
5. 其他辅助工具
- Nmap:一款开源的网络扫描工具,可以用于检测网络漏洞。
- Wireshark:一款开源的网络协议分析工具,可以用于分析网络流量。
总结
应对DDoS攻击需要综合考虑多种因素,包括网络安全意识、防护措施和应急响应等。通过使用上述软件和工具,可以有效降低DDoS攻击带来的风险,确保网络安全。记住,网络安全是一个持续的过程,需要我们时刻保持警惕。
